Boost for Sustainable Transportation in Kenya with Launch of First Electric Vans

Picture of two men with a van

Electric Vans help save on major costs compared to any internal combustion engine vehicle. They greatly reduce operating expenses as they beat the diesel competition hands down costing less than half for fuel, Service, maintenance and repairs at very reasonable mileage. In addition EV’s are zero-emission thus promoting cleaner air and aiding in the fight against pollution and climate change.
